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> sistemi >> Competenze informatiche di base >> .

Quali sono i passaggi che dicono al computer come eseguire un compito particolare?

I passaggi che dicono a un computer come eseguire un compito particolare sono chiamati istruzioni . Queste istruzioni sono scritte in una lingua che il computer può capire, chiamato codice macchina .

Ecco una rottura di come funziona:

1. Lingua di programmazione: Scrivi le istruzioni in un linguaggio di programmazione come Python, Java o C ++. Questo linguaggio è più leggibile dall'uomo del codice macchina.

2. Compilatore/Interpreter: Un compilatore o un interprete traduce il codice in codice macchina. Questo codice è una serie di quelli e zeri che il processore del computer può comprendere direttamente.

3. Codice macchina: Il codice macchina è un insieme di istruzioni che indicano al computer di eseguire azioni specifiche come:

* Operazioni aritmetiche: Aggiungi, sottrai, moltiplica, dividi, ecc.

* Manipolazione dei dati: Spostare i dati in memoria, confrontare i valori.

* Input/Output: Ottieni dati dalla tastiera, visualizza le informazioni sullo schermo.

* Flusso di controllo: Decidere quali istruzioni eseguire successive in base a determinate condizioni.

4. Esecuzione: L'unità di elaborazione centrale (CPU) del computer legge le istruzioni del codice macchina ed le esegue una dopo l'altra. Questo processo continua fino al termine del programma.

Ecco un'analogia: Immagina di insegnare a un robot per preparare un panino. Lo daresti istruzioni dettagliate come:

1. Apri il frigorifero.

2. Elimina il pane.

3. Distribuire il burro sul pane.

4. Aggiungi formaggio.

5. Chiudi il frigorifero.

Queste istruzioni sono come il codice di programmazione. Il robot può comprendere solo comandi molto semplici, quindi devi abbattere l'attività in piccoli passaggi.

In sintesi: I passaggi che dicono a un computer come eseguire un compito particolare sono chiamati istruzioni. Sono scritti in un linguaggio di programmazione e quindi tradotti in codice macchina, che il computer può comprendere ed eseguire.

 

sistemi © www.354353.com